Anchovies from nearby Collioure, cured in salt or oil. They are a defining speciality of the Côte Vermeille and central to local tapas and seaside meals.
A Catalan fish stew with monkfish or other catch, potatoes, aioli and saffron. It reflects the fishing traditions of the Roussillon coast.
Traditional Catalan snails cooked with cured ham, sausage, tomato and herbs. It is a rustic regional dish often shared at family meals and festivals.

Free, unlimited high-speed Wi-Fi when you create a free account. ATMs are the ATM is located in the connecting corridor between Hall 1 and Hall 2 opposite Relay.
The ticket office is open Mon - Fri: 08:15 - 19:40, Sat: 08:15 - 18:40, Sun: 09:35 - 19:40. Information desks are located in the main concourse.
Luggage storage is service provided by Grand Hôtel d'Orléans, located opposite the station. Fixed pricing per piece of baggage: small baggage: €5.50, medium baggage: €7.50, large baggage: €9.50.
